Transaction 833d752b3034f34e883118624976e858c04ee21007808deab0f934b6fef751ab

2 Input
2 Outputs
  • 833d752b3034f34e883118624976e858c04ee21007808deab0f934b6fef751ab:0
  • value  25000000
    address  14GJZ467nDwHSfN21gfkufTn9AgEqTBygP
  • 833d752b3034f34e883118624976e858c04ee21007808deab0f934b6fef751ab:1
  • value  176143
    address  1DhQEQTtFpP3ahkvCe4xEFtiaAU3KH3rxz